Yes. Zimbabwe recognises South African drivers licences without any problems. It is necessary to also have your passport available as a back-up document, but it is seldom needed.

Small roadblocks are common, usually you will find one on either side of rural towns. Be nice to the officer, smile, be patient and ignore any requests for bribes.

How do you drive with a license from a foreign country in South Dakota?

A person who has a driver's license from another country must have an International Driving Permit (IDP) from the same country that issued their driver's license and must carry both the IDP and their driver's license with them in order to drive in South Dakota. They must also follow South Dakota's laws.
